Headaches are often accompanied by neck pain. These types of headaches are sometimes called cervicogenic headaches. Relaxing the muscles around the neck and shoulder area with these stretches and exercise may help relieve the headache as well as the neck pain.
My favorite exercise for Neck Pain Relief is a chin tuck. It’s great for the neck and shoulder, it can help relieve headaches, and it can also help correct posture.
